The Turkish Language and Literature program aims to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of the language and its rich literary heritage, rooted in deep historical and geographical contexts. Through the utilization of modern research methods, students learn to analyze and interpret Turkish literary texts effectively. Additionally, the program equips students with teaching methods specific to the Turkish language and literature, enabling them to educate others at various levels. Furthermore, the program seeks to foster an appreciation for Turkology on the international stage, preparing students to engage in international relations within the framework of Turkology's global reach. By imparting knowledge that facilitates closer ties with the Turkish world, the program aims to cultivate students' maturity in navigating international connections and cultural exchanges.
